How Does Avéli Work for Cellulite?
Avéli addresses the cause of cellulite, fibrous bands (septae) that pull the skin down and create a dimpled appearance. The unique Avéli device has a long, flexible probe with a hooked blade and a light at the end. The probe is inserted under the skin through a tiny incision and moved toward a targeted dimple. The light glows through the skin to ensure the targeted dimple is reached. Once the blade is hooked around the associated septae, the provider snips the band, allowing the skin to smooth out.

Your Treatment Experience
Cellulite treatment with Avéli is minimally invasive and relatively brief, requiring only local anesthesia. Dr. Hasen begins by numbing the area you want treated. He then creates a small incision and inserts the probe just beneath the skin. For each targeted dimple, Dr. Hasen releases the associated septae.
Because the Avéli probe is so small, no sutures are needed. Bleeding is minimal, and thanks to the local anesthetic, the procedure is quite comfortable. You can expect your appointment to last between 45 minutes and 1 hour.
The Recovery
Although minor soreness, swelling, and bruising are common after Avéli, most patients feel well enough to resume their normal activities within a few days. No prescribed pain medication is necessary.
The Result
Although the results of Avéli aren’t instant, they do develop quickly. And once they appear, they’re very long-lasting. Many patients say they notice fewer dimples and an overall improvement in their treated areas after just 3 days. Over the next few weeks, the skin will continue to look smoother.
